Jurnal Riset Komunikasi (JURKOM) Print ISSN 2615-0875 | Online ISSN 2615-0948 is a scientific journal published by Asosiasi Pendidikan Tinggi Ilmu Komunikasi (ASPIKOM) Riau Region. JURKOM focuses on communication issues in general including communication science, journalism, Public Relations, communication management, development communication, new media, strategic communication, broadcasting, and etc.

Abstract

The development of sustainability concept make the implementation of corporate social responsibility more intense. These developments has led to change the topic of corporate social responsibility. The aims of this study are (1) to highlight popular topic about the research of corporate social responsibility, (2) to visualization network mapping between keywords about the research of corporate social responsibility, and (3) to find research opportunities about corporate social responsibility for future. This research used quantitative methods with bibliometric analysis approach using co-occurrence analysis. This research used ProQuest database with 57 scholarly journals as population and seven scholarly journal that fulfil the indicator. The result shows that, based on keywords, the implementation of corporate social responsibility focused on social and environmental issues with external reinforcement.

Abstract

TThis research aims to investigate the production of horror contents in the INSENTIF podcast channel by Tirto.id, an Indonesian online news media. When journalistic media are involved in the production of ghost stories and mystery, it raises concerns about journalistic basic principles of providing verified information. To understand this phenomenon, we conducted a qualitative case study and interviewed three key informants from the INSENTIF production team. Using Giddens’ structuration theory as an analysis framework, we identify that the INSENTIF production crews still perceive their routine as part of journalistic works. In writing the script, they strive to rely on credible sources and actualise the discipline of verification although they admit that they insert some fictional horrific scenarios at the beginning of each episode as well. Thus, they mention a disclaimer, explaining that their journalism practice, specifically on horror episodes, is not the same as the regular Tirto.id’s standard journalism. This research argues that the agents, in this case, seem to follow and reproduce the existing structure, rather than resist it.

Abstract

The implementation of immersive journalism as part of digital journalism is now starting to penetrate YouTube. CNN Indonesia is a media company that uses 360 degree video technology to present news. The use of virtual reality technology raises ethical questions that require consideration by news producers to maintain journalistic standards. This study aims to understand the modality and ethics of immersive journalism implemented in CNN Indonesia's 360 degree video content on YouTube through quantitative content analysis. The concept of modality, ethics of immersive journalism, and the theory of media richness are used as analytical tools to understand modality and immersion presented in CNN Indonesia's 360 video. The results of the study show that CNN Indonesia's 360-degree video content follows the ethics of sensitive content, on the other hand, the modalities used are still limited.

Abstract

The first case of Omicron BA.4 and BA.5 subvariants on 9 June 2022 confirmed by the Government has propelled a news explosion. This article examines what discourses constructed by public communicators who addressed this case, as reported by the online media, and who are they? We analyze online news related to this issue published in between 9 and 16 June 2022 using the discourse network analysis. We found 15 categories of discourse related to this case advocated by five types of public communicators. They consist of 25 types of specific actors. While some of them advocated types of discourses identified by Ali and Eriyanto (2020), most of them formulated new discourses when they addressed this case. Our research also revealed that public communicators that represent the Government do not have a single discourse when they managed this case. This hints that the Government lacked an integrated public communication strategy in handling this case

Abstract

The existence of tourism development policies that are not supported by integrated communication activities makes tourism problems in Bengkalis Regency increasingly complex. Disparbudpora has made Bengkalis Regency a cultural tourism destination through destination branding. This study aims to determine the destination branding process for Bengkalis Regency by the Board of Tourism, Culture, Youth and Sports (Disparbudpora) as a cultural tourism destination. The research method used is qualitative with a descriptive case study approach. The results of this study indicate that Disparbudpora of Bengkalis Regency introduces cultural tourism destinations by carrying out 5 stages of destination branding. The first stage is market investigation, analysis and strategic recommendation, namely by collecting secondary data, field surveys and data analysis. The two stages of Brand identity development, using the Sembayung logo and the tagline Bengkalis diversity of culture. The three stages of brand launch and introduction are carried out through digital communication and special events which are held annually. The four brand implementations are carried out in accordance with the program set in RIPPARDA 2021-2035. Fifth, Brand monitoring, evaluation and review is carried out directly, through the UPT Tourism and destination managers and Evaluation, a review that discusses the data that has been collected regarding the deficiencies and advantages of destinations.

Abstract

This study examines the topic of environmental sustainability, which is currently emphasized by governments and organizations. How do organizations, in particular, utilize the term "green" to designate their products and services? A green label plays a crucial role in establishing a favorable reputation for an organization, allowing it to be identified as a promoter of environmental sustainability. This study explores the utilization of the green concept on Twitter deeper. Utilizing the Netlytic program, tweets containing the terms "green" or "environmental" are submitted to a content analysis. This study shows, using collected data, that Twitter is utilized as a "technology weapon" to promote the organization's image. By accommodating digital traces by users on Twitter, researchers see a "digital space" formed to be utilized as a space for organizations to produce content based on environmental communication. This information has consequences for the green labeling of an organization and enables the enhancement of a good image that adds value to the organization's reputation to establish itself as a pro-environmental organization. Important findings from this study suggest that Twitter could be utilized by organizations to improve their status on the map as a green organization.

Abstract

Online news portals are widely accessed by the public to get various information. There are two online news portals that are well known by the Indonesian people, namely Tempo.co and Kompas.com. Since 2019, those two news portals have not stopped providing information about the Covid-19 pandemic, especially regarding mental illness due to the pandemic. By using framing theory, this study aims to find out how the differences in the representation of mental illness on Tempo.co and Kompas.com. This study uses quantitative content analysis method to analyze texts on online news portal. Sampling was carried out using probability simple random sampling technique during the PSBB period in Jakarta, from April 10 to June 4, 2020. A sample of 65 news articles on Tempo.co and 100 news articles on Kompas.com were taken based on six keywords, those are “penyakit mental”, “penyakit jiwa”, “gangguan mental”, “gangguan jiwa”, “kesehatan mental”, and “kesehatan jiwa”. Data were analyzed using nonparametric statistical calculations chi square contingency coefficient. The results showed that there were differences in the representation of danger-to-self characteristic on Tempo.co and Kompas.com, but there were no differences in the representations of causes, solutions, and tone of articles on Tempo.co and Kompas.com.

Abstract

Broadcasting in Indonesia experienced significant progress by technology migration (analog switch-off/ ASO). Unfortunately, the announced migration does not apply to radio broadcasting technology. The broadcast radio ecosystem before ASO experienced a decline, coupled with the exclusion of radio from major broadcasting decisions. This research used an interpretive paradigm and a case study approach on private broadcasting radio ecosystem in Pekanbaru. It was carried out using convergent mixed research methods and the theory of media ecology and actor-network theory and involved 204 listeners as informants who were approached by road surveys. Furthermore, this study involved the person in charge of the media and the media supervisor, who was found to be using a purposive method. The study’s findings: (1) broadcast media (radio) represented through social media connectivity is a new ecosystem found in the element of broadcast radio proximity; (2) relationships through broadcasting technology are a solution in innovation as a convergence effort (broadcast-broadband) as a new broadcasting forum for private radio broadcasts, so to maintain the sustainability of the broadcasting (radio) ecosystem, technological and regulatory connectivity is needed in preparing a new forum for the broadcasting industry, especially radio broadcasting.

Abstract

Communication planning is an essential part of a public organization such as BPTJ. In carrying out its duties and roles, BPTJ Public Relations is required to develop appropriate communication plans based on the stages carried out to achieve the main objectives of the PR communication program itself, namely building opinions and changing behavior. The purpose of this study was to identify and analyze the planning stages of the BPTJ Public Relations communication program, the model run by BPTJ Public Relations, and the challenges and obstacles in carrying out communication program planning. The theory used is the Assifi and French communication planning, model. This study uses a qualitative descriptive method with data collection techniques through in-depth interviews and literature studies. Based on the results of the research, it can be interpreted that BPTJ Public Relations has carried out the planning communication stages from problem analysis to evaluation. The Assifi and French models have been implemented by BPTJ Public Relations and have challenges and obstacles both internal and external to the organization. The recommendation of this research is that BPTJ Public Relations must have a standard concept of a communication plan, be consistent in terms of visual appearance on social media such as corporate color and optimize public figures as communicator.
